Overview
FTI is looking for an experienced Integration Engineer with DevOps or DevSecOps (Development / Security / Operations) experience to join our growing organization. This position requires experience with Continuous Integration/Continuous Deployment (CI/CD) using pipelines to automatically take committed code, run it through tests, and optionally, deploy that code into production. A keen attention to detail, problem-solving abilities, and solid knowledge base are essential . The ideal candidate will have extensive experience working with Space/Ground Systems across the Department of Defense (DoD) Space domain. This work will primarily be performed in Colorado Springs, CO, with travel to integration sites as required .

Responsibilities
- Follow established protocols and develop new procedures to deploy integrated systems.
- Analyze requirements and integrate functionality.
- Troubleshoot issues and provide solutions.
- Strive to decrease overall latency in development and deployment cycles by applying DevOps/ DevSecOps best practices.
- Create and maintain the CI/CD pipeline.
- Be a champion of infrastructure as code, deployment automation, test automation, and configuration management process (Automate Everything!).
- Work in a team environment with minimal supervision.
- Continually obtain new skills and be a mentor for junior team members.
- Must be a U.S. Citizen and possess an active Top Secret (TS) security clearance (with SCI and SAP eligibility).
- Bachelor’s Degree in Computer Sciences , Engineering or related field required ( Master’s degree preferred).
- 6 years' experience with Integration/DevOps.
- Understanding of Space Force ground architectures, to include Overhead Persistent Infrared (OPIR) ground systems (desired).
- Experience with Platform as a Service (PAAS).
- Experience with Linux infrastructures.
- Experience with D atabase SQL (MS SQL), CI/CD tools .
- Experience with S cripting tools such as Python, Perl, Ruby .
- Hands-on experience with building and managing release systems, code merging and promotion, and CI/CD workflows and tools.
- Experience working with DevOps/ DevSecOps toolchain products, including Ansible/Chef/Puppet, Artifactory, Jenkins, GIT in production environments.
- Experience with revision control source code repositories (Git, SVN, Mercurial, Perforce.)
- Experience working with and delivering using Agile practices.
- Monitoring experience with Splunk, Elk, Kibana, Grafana, etc.
- Previous experience with infrastructure development, or development and operations .
- Experience with development and automated testing.
- Experience performing deployments into an operational environment.
- Familiar with integration environment security/vulnerability tools, and experience securing the integration environment configuration and enforcing security policies.
- Experience implementing modern IT solutions in compliance with U.S. Government and DoD Cybersecurity frameworks (e.g., NIST/DoD RMF/DISA STIG and SRG).
- Knowledge of / familiar with containerization concepts (OpenShift, Docker) .
- E xperience with system administration tasks to include installing/configuring/securing common Operating Systems (RHEL and Windows).
- Sufficient familiarity with network technologies (routing, firewalls, VLANs) to be able to troubleshoot connectivity issues.
- Working knowledge with or understand deploying environments with Terraform.
- Strong interpersonal skills and communication with all levels of management .
- Ability to multitask, prioritize, and manage time efficiently.
- Ability to work independently with geographically dispersed team.
- Travel 20%
